My bus was outside when it hailed, i had exactly 0 seconds to respond to the first hail stone. My roof looks like Jlos ass, all the dents are golf ball size.....except four, they are bigger than than my fist. The dents must measure about 15 cms accross and about 3 or 4 cms deep. Passanger winscreen is smashed completly, passenger indicator in smashed, drivers wiper arm is really badly damaged. I fell into a mild depression when i assesd the damage. I saw a 530d that was writen off because of hail damage, the roof had collapsed and the bonnet was distorted so badly it couldnt close.

My house has 26 broken windows......there were hail stones bigger than cricket balls in my garden. My bathroom is about 10m from my kitchen,directly down the passage, and i was picking up entire, intact hailstones as well as shards of glass on the bathroom floor, my father-in-law had hail stones buried 2 inches into his lawn. A friend of mine had to admit his daughtet into hospital after she was hit by a hail stone, another friends daughter is in hospital after a hail stone smashed througb the lounge window and through the glass table his duaghter was playing at,...lodging a piece of glass in her forehead. I have seen and repared some incredible hail damage,but i have nexer seen anything like what i saw on saturday
